Beispiel #1
0
		/// ------------------------------------------------------------------------------------
		/// <summary>
		/// Create and initializes a new sidebar/info. bar adapter. - from FwMainWnd.cs
		/// </summary>
		/// ------------------------------------------------------------------------------------
		protected void CreateSideBarInfoBarAdapter()
		{
			m_sibAdapter = AdapterHelper.CreateSideBarInfoBarAdapter();

			if (m_sibAdapter != null)
				m_sibAdapter.Initialize(this/*m_sideBarContainer*/, m_infoBarContainer, m_mediator);
		}
Beispiel #2
0
		public void SetUp()
		{
			m_mediator = new Mediator();
			m_parent = new Panel();

			m_sibAdapter = new SIBAdapter();
			Debug.Assert(m_sibAdapter != null);
			m_sibAdapter.Initialize(m_parent, m_infoBarContainer, m_mediator);
		}
Beispiel #3
0
        /// ------------------------------------------------------------------------------------
        /// <summary>
        /// Create and initializes a new sidebar/info. bar adapter. - from FwMainWnd.cs
        /// </summary>
        /// ------------------------------------------------------------------------------------
        protected void CreateSideBarInfoBarAdapter()
        {
            m_sibAdapter = AdapterHelper.CreateSideBarInfoBarAdapter();

            if (m_sibAdapter != null)
            {
                m_sibAdapter.Initialize(this /*m_sideBarContainer*/, m_infoBarContainer, m_mediator);
            }
        }
Beispiel #4
0
        public void SetUp()
        {
            m_mediator = new Mediator();
            m_parent   = new Panel();

            m_sibAdapter = new SIBAdapter();
            Debug.Assert(m_sibAdapter != null);
            m_sibAdapter.Initialize(m_parent, m_infoBarContainer, m_mediator);
        }
        /// ------------------------------------------------------------------------------------
        /// <summary>
        ///
        /// </summary>
        /// <returns>An instance of a sidebar/information bar adapter.</returns>
        /// ------------------------------------------------------------------------------------
        public static ISIBInterface CreateSideBarInfoBarAdapter()
        {
            if (MiscUtils.RunningTests || !LoadUIAdapterAssembly())
            {
                return(null);
            }

            ISIBInterface sibAdapter = (ISIBInterface)m_uiAdapterAssembly.CreateInstance(
                "SIL.FieldWorks.Common.UIAdapters.SIBAdapter");

            Debug.Assert(sibAdapter != null, "Could not create a side bar/info. bar adapter.");
            return(sibAdapter);
        }